Title :
Pattern recognition of star constellations for spacecraft applications
Author :
Liebe, Carl Christian
Author_Institution :
Dept. of Electrophys., Tech. Univ. of Denmark, Lyngby, Denmark
Abstract :
A software system for a star imager for on-line satellite attitude determination is described. The system works with a single standard commercial CCD-camera with a high aperture lens and an onboard star catalogue. It is capable of both an initial course attitude determination without any prior knowledge of the satellite orientation and a high-accuracy attitude determination based on prediction and averaging of several identified star constellations. In the high accuracy mode the star imager aims at an accuracy better than 2 arc sec with a processing time of less than a few seconds. The star imager is developed for the Danish microsatellite Oersted.<>
